All the cars share the same engine, an M103 2.6L
The 260E and 300E 2.6 are the w124 platform The 190E 2.6 is the w201 platform. The 124 is a bit larger and roomier than the 201. But I like my 201. Its currently up on stands in my garage waiting a replacement steering arm ![]()

Marketing Trick
You could buy a 300e with an optional extra - smaller engine. You could also remove the 2.6 badge and still say you owned a 300e - as per the data card. Some Asian countries had engine size restrictions. One I worked in, restricted the maximum engine size to 2.8 litres. That's why you see a lot of the older euro cars with that particular size engine and less. |
